"I'll put an addendum on this: I shouldn't be entering tournaments yet. I'm an old bastard; 2nd Edition born and raised and I've been on a gaming hiatus of about 3 years. Only in the last 2-3 months have I started playing again and I'm still not entirely used to the edition or my army.

Game 1 was vs Deathwing. Footslogging, entirely. I lol'd heartily and set about the table being a clever chap and systematically taking him to pieces. Or I would have, had not a single unit in the entire 1750pt army passed night fighting, almost every single terminator unit managed to run 6 and the two that didn't managed to make my kroot shields run away by causing the bare minimum or casualties. Turn 2, I was completely fucked. The mission's 'thing' was that scoring units were worth 3 KPs each and by the end of turn 2 I'd lost four of them. Massacred by footslogging deathwing. I killed four in the end. Four terminators. In a 7-turn game. Luckily my opponent was a nice guy. If he'd been smug I'd probably have beaten him to death with a statue of the dice god.

Game 2 was vs chaos demons. The mission was that there were 5 enemy units we designated as kill points and nothing else was worth anything. There were also 5 objectives. Can't really blame the dice on this one, although it was close: I'd taken out all of my designated targets and he'd only taken out 3. I feel awful stupid right now because we wrote down that I lost, but it was actually a draw. I had 5KPs, he had 3KPs and 2 objectives. He said he claimed 3, but one was contested. Bugger. Discovery. Thoughts;

-Assaulting with detached vehicle gun drones is actually not useless. I managed to knock him off an objective on turn 5 by swinging a piranha up to a beaten up unit of horrors, blasting them with the carbines then assaulting the one who remained and taking him out. Piranha guns 12" and (since it's open topped) you get an 18" assault. If you fail, they're just gun drones.
-Tank shock is broken. I'm not one to say that rules are broken often, but I've found that tank shocking devilfish have been significantly game-changing in at least half of the games I've played. You swing in last turn and push enemy troops off the objective. If you're half-clever (I.e. IQ above room temperature), you'll do it so your own troops grab it and theirs can't contest. Sure everyone's packed to the gunwales with anti-tank, but we're talking turn 5-6 here. Any unit sitting on an objective has probably been targeted enough that their special and heavy weapons have gone splat.
-As someone who's just played their first game against demons, I can't help but wonder why they caused such a clamour on their release. The entire army is based on luck. Even the best general in the world is likely to lose from time-to-time with demons because they're just too random to be used effectively. Like I said, I drew my very first game against them ever. Never seen then before, never read tactics against them or even given them a thought. All things considered, I should've lost horribly. I just clumped in a corner to prevent DS chickanery and forced him to drop down miles away and spend 3 turns footslogging his was over to me.

Game 3 was vs mech Eldar. Some lucky night-fighting rolls and I managed to cripple two of his vehicles turn 1 (advanced stabilisation is amazing. I retract my previous derisive comments) Once again, tank shocking fire warriors to the rescue, riding in hard to steal an objective on turn 5. I should get Ride of the Valkyries and blast it whenever I tank shock. If only my hammerhead had managed to survive one more turn it would've been a draw as he was contesting an objective (vehicles could contest in the mission). Alas, a (very lucky) haywire grenade managed to bring him down which meant instead of 1 contested, 1 held by me, 1 by him it was two held by him, 1 by me.

Rightyho, here's the finalised list I used;

XV8 Commander Shas'El
Plasma Rifle, Missile Pod, Multitracker, Bonding Knife

2 XV8 Crisis Battlesuits
Plasma Rifle, Missile Pod, Multitracker

3 XV8 Crisis Battlesuits
Plasma Rifle, Missile Pod, Multitracker, team leader w. bonding knife

6 Fire Warriors

10 Kroot, 7 Kroot Hounds

10 Kroot, 3 Hounds

11 Fire Warriors
Shas'Ui w. bonding knife in/
Devilfish
Smart Missile System, disruption pod, multitracker

8 Pathfinders
Shas'Ui w. bonding knife in/
Devilfish
Smart Missile System, disruption pod, multitracker

Piranha Light Skimmer
Fusion Blaster, disruption pod, targeting array

Hammerhead Gunship
Railgun, burst cannons, disruption pod, multitracker

Hammerhead Gunship
Railgun, burst cannons, disruption pod, multitracker

2 XV88 Broadside Battlesuits
Advanced Stabilisation Systems, Team leader w. bonding knife, hard-wired target lock, hard-wired drone controller
2 Shield Drones
